Summary: The lectro-hydraulic linear actuator (or push rod) is a self-contained unit that converts electric power into powerful, precise linear pushing/pulling motion using internal hydraulic pressure. I
Core functions and features:
Linear Motion Generation: Converts rotational torque from an electric motor into linear pushing or pulling action.
Compact Self-Contained System: Combines a motor, pump, and cylinder into one, eliminating the need for external hydraulic pumps, hoses, or tanks.
High Force & Durability: Designed for heavy-duty loads in challenging environments, often featuring sealed units resistant to dust and water (IP67/IP69K).
Force & Velocity Control: Provides precise speed regulation, typically operating between 42mm-50mm/s, with the ability to handle high-duty cycles.
Industrial Application: Frequently used in metallurgy (tilting converters), building materials (opening dampers), and general automation for machinery.
Key Advantages:
Shock Resistance: The internal fluid system absorbs shock loads, protecting the unit from damage.
Safety & Protection: Many models include built-in overload protection, making them ideal for high-temperature or explosion-proof environments.
Energy Efficient: Operates only when needed, reducing energy consumption compared to continuously running hydraulic systems.
